🌟 Bonus: An Old-School Garlic Storage Trick 🧦
Fill nylon stockings with garlic heads and hang in a cool, dry place (like a cellar). The thin fabric provides ventilation and protects garlic from spoiling. This classic method has stood the test of time!

🗝️ 3 Golden Rules for Perfect Winter Garlic Storage 🔒
✔️ Only Store Healthy Garlic Heads
Check every bulb before storage — any damaged or moldy clove risks spoiling the whole batch ❌. Only choose firm, unblemished heads.

✔️ Control Temperature & Humidity
Keep garlic in a cool (about 16°C/60°F for spring garlic, max 5°C/41°F for winter garlic), dry place with humidity around 50-70%. Too much moisture causes mold; too little dries out the cloves 💧⚠️.

✔️ Store Garlic in the Dark
Light speeds up spoilage and encourages pests 🕯️🐜. A dark cellar or pantry is perfect for keeping garlic fresh longer.
